Improving instrument air system performance

Instrument air systems support the front-line operating systems at nuclear power plants by providing high-quality air to instruments and controls. Since plants are designed so that this air is not needed for achieving safe shutdown, instrument air systems do not have to be safety-grade. From the standpoint of electricity production, however, it is vital that they be as reliable and economical as possible. EPRI is developing information and products to help utilities improve the performance of these complex systems. Three reference reports are already available, and a new computer-based system, the Instrument Air Diagnostic Advisor, is nearing completion. Intended to be both a training and a diagnostic tool, IADA can help plant personnel consider the full range of possible problems and corrective actions
